## Deployment

ThumbNest is the thumbnail generation queue that backs the Larkfield media portal. For the weekly eng sync: deploys go through the standard blue/green flow, and workers drain in-flight jobs before shutdown, so expect up to five minutes of overlap. Scale the consumer count before bulk re-ingest events, not after. Health checks gate promotion automatically. Each environment reads its settings at boot, and the current production values are shown below.

service settings:
HOLIX_HOST=holix.qorvelsys.internal
HOLIX_PORT=7000

Subject: Incremental rebuilds now default on Thistledocs

Team — incremental static rebuilds are now the default for the Thistledocs site as of this morning. For the new contractor: full rebuilds are no longer triggered on every merge; only changed pages and their dependents regenerate. If you see stale content, don't force a full rebuild — file it in the Wrenbury board so we can fix the dependency graph instead. Rollback path is documented in the release wiki. The deploy that enabled this is identified by the token below.

pipeline stamp: htk31_f769b577b3028a4e9958e5bb8d1259a

- [ ] **Step 7: Breaker override escrow.** After sealing the signing keys for the Tallgrove upstream API circuit breaker, confirm the support team can force the breaker open during a full outage. The override bundle lives in the sealed escrow drawer and is useless without its unlock phrase. Two ceremony witnesses must initial this step before proceeding. The escrow bundle is decrypted with the recovery passphrase that follows.

vault phrase of kahip-kahop = holath-quenmir